Worship the TENORI-ON!

Last night I took a mini break from my duties in the motion graphics industry and attended a concert of Berlin-Düsseldorf-based band To Rococo Rot at Munich’s Rote Sonne promoting their forthcoming album “abc 123” (wich will be released on Domino Records in October). Not only was the music highly enjoyable but I also got the chance to get close to their brand new TENORI-ON, Yamaha’s über-cool ‘visible music’ instrument which they've obviously got only a few days ago.

In case you’re living in Berlin you got lucky: there will be one last concert on Sunday night at the Babylon.

iPhone. Unlocked. Free.

Here’s about giving something to the community: Gizmodo feat. the usual suspects presents us with the first working free iPhone software unlock. So apart from running dozens of additional apps you are now free to choose your own carrier, and maybe even hook the little one up to the etherwaves in good old Europe. (World peace to follow soon.)

Sounds pretty good to me.

Getting literally paralyzed by the abundance of brain-damaging ringtones on the internets and in the real world around me, I was pleased to hear about toneShared.com – a library of fantabulous soundbits created by musicians and artists from the electronic alternative music scene. And not only are these tones so much less annoying than commercial ringers, but also they are given away completely for free. So there’s little excuse not to get some decent sounds pronto.
